Abstract
Potentially inappropriate medications impact pharmacotherapy for the older adult in critical care settings. Critical care teams must be aware of the Beers and Screening Tool of Older Person's Prescriptions criteria as resources to identify medications that may cause adverse drug events in the elderly. Although criteria should not replace clinical judgment, awareness of these guidelines may direct critical care teams to minimize dosing and duration of potentially inappropriate medications to improve outcomes in the intensive care unit.
